#51f3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#51f3ba is composed of 31.8% red, 95.3%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 158.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 63.5%. #51f3ba color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ffff with #00e775.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#51f3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010906 is the darkest color, while #f6f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#51f3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a4a3 is the less saturated color, while #4afabc is the most saturated one.
